What is Body Integrity Identity Disorder (BIID)?

Body Integrity Identity Disorder, often abbreviated as BIID, is a rare psychological condition. Individuals with BIID feel a strong desire to become disabled or to have a part of their body amputated. This feeling is not due to physical illness; instead, it’s an intense emotional experience that can be hard to understand.

Symptoms of BIID

People with BIID may experience a range of symptoms, including:

  • Desire for Amputation: A persistent wish to have a limb or body part removed.
  • Feeling of Incongruence: A deep sense that their body does not match their internal identity.
  • Distress: Emotional pain related to their feelings about their body.

Types and Categories of BIID

While BIID can manifest in various ways, there are a few common categories:

  1. Limb Amputation: The most reported form, where individuals wish to lose a leg or arm.
  2. Paraplegia: Some may want to experience paralysis, feeling that it would better fit their identity.
  3. Blindness: Others may desire to lose their sight, believing it aligns with how they see themselves.
